About The Position

Air is a Creative Ops System for creative teams. Our product automates the mindless tasks that creatives and marketers do every day to manage content and unlocks creativity through image recognition, automated versioning, and approval workflows. This role requires in-office attendance at least 3 days/week in New York City. As a Scaled Account Manager at Air, you'll own a large book of business and serve as a strategic partner to your customers — educating them on new product lines and tiers, driving adoption, and identifying upsell opportunities that align with their needs. Your goal: ensure every customer realizes the full value of Air's evolving platform while growing revenue through smart, intentional account management. This is a revenue-generating role that blends relationship building with real business impact. You'll carry a quota with variable compensation, directly tying your success to the company's growth.
